Tanner Scott Joins Dodgers: A Four-Year Gamble That Could Pay Off Big

So, the Dodgers just inked Tanner Scott to a four-year deal. Four years! That's a bold move, right? It's got the baseball world buzzing, and honestly, I'm right there with them, a mixture of intrigued excitement and slightly nervous anticipation. This isn't your typical, "safe" signing. This is a gamble, a high-stakes poker game where the pot is a potential World Series win, and the ante is a significant chunk of the Dodgers' budget. Let's dive into why this move is so fascinating and what it could mean for the future of the team.

The Scott Situation: More Than Just Fastballs

Tanner Scott isn't your average relief pitcher. He's a power arm, no doubt. The guy throws heat—we're talking triple-digit fastballs, the kind that make hitters' eyes water and leave them wondering what just happened. But he's also known for his… let's call it "inconsistent control." Think of him as a high-octane sports car with a slightly wonky steering wheel. Amazing speed, thrilling potential, but requires a skilled driver (read: pitching coach) to truly harness its power.

The High-Risk, High-Reward Profile

This isn't about just throwing hard, though. The Dodgers saw something beyond the raw velocity. They saw a pitcher with the potential to become an absolute shutdown reliever—the kind who can erase a jam in the ninth inning with a devastating strikeout. But they also know the risk. The walks can be a problem. Control issues are a real concern. This contract is a bet on their ability to refine his skills and unlock his true potential.

A Closer Look at the Numbers

Let's not bury our heads in the sand. The numbers tell a story. High strikeouts? Absolutely. But also a high walk rate. That's the double-edged sword. The Dodgers are hoping their pitching development program—renowned for its effectiveness—can help Scott refine his command. They've successfully done this before, turning potential flame-throwers into consistent assets. But this time, the stakes are higher.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the biggest risk associated with the Tanner Scott contract? The biggest risk is Scott's inconsistency and control issues. While he possesses incredible velocity, his high walk rate has been a persistent problem throughout his career. The Dodgers are banking on their coaching staff significantly improving his command.

2. How does this signing affect the Dodgers' other relief pitchers? This signing likely adds pressure to other relief pitchers on the roster to compete for roles. It also signals a potential shift in bullpen roles and utilization strategies.

3. What specific aspects of Tanner Scott's game are the Dodgers hoping to improve? The primary focus will likely be on refining Scott's command and reducing his walk rate. Minor adjustments to his mechanics, grip, and overall approach could significantly impact his performance.

4. How does this four-year contract compare to other similar signings in recent years? This is a longer-term commitment than many recent signings of similarly volatile relief pitchers. It indicates a higher degree of confidence from the Dodgers in their ability to develop Scott's potential.
